We formulate a conjecture for the three different Lax operators that d
escribe the bosonic sectors of the three possible N = 2 supersymmetric
integrable hierarchies with N = 2 super-W-n second Hamiltonian struct
ure. We check this conjecture in the simplest cases, then we verify it
in general in one of the three possible supersymmetric extensions, To
this end we construct the N = 2 supersymmetric extensions of the Gene
ralized Non-Linear Schrodinger hierarchy by exhibiting the correspondi
ng super Lax operator. To find the correct Hamiltonians we are led to
a new definition of super-residues for degenerate N = 2 supersymmetric
pseudo-differential operators. We have found a new non-polynomials Mi
ura-like realization for N = 2 superconformal algebra in terms of two
bosonic chiral-anti-chiral free superfields.
